This important legislation will allow you to include dietary supplements as

valid health expenses on your taxes and through the pre-tax flexible medical

spending accounts and health savings accounts you fund. This will save you

hundreds of dollars each year when you purchase health promoting dietary

All we need to do to create this change is pass the Dietary Supplement Tax

Fairness legislation introduced in Congress. This bill simply adds dietary

supplements to the list of products and services considered valid health

expenses in the IRS tax code.

am very excited to learn about the bi-partisan bill H.R. 2627, the Dietary

Supplement Tax Fairness Act. This legislation would amend the Internal

Revenue Code from 1986 to provide that monetary amounts paid for dietary

supplements, foods for special dietary use or medical foods shall be treated

as medical expenses. This legislation would help consumers afford many

natural, less expensive, healthcare options, not just the conventional and

pharmaceutical options that are covered by the existing tax code.
